Millennium Management LLC Acquires 92,068 Shares of Arbutus Biopharma Co. (NASDAQ:ABUS)

Arbutus Biopharma logo with Medical background

Millennium Management LLC raised its stake in Arbutus Biopharma Co. (NASDAQ:ABUS - Free Report) by 36.7% in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 343,028 shares of the biopharmaceutical company's stock after acquiring an additional 92,068 shares during the quarter. Millennium Management LLC owned about 0.18% of Arbutus Biopharma worth $1,122,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

About Arbutus Biopharma

(Free Report)

Arbutus Biopharma Corporation, a biopharmaceutical company, develops novel therapeutics for chronic Hepatitis B virus (HBV) infection in the United States. Its HBV product pipeline consists of imdusiran (AB-729), a proprietary subcutaneously-delivered RNAi therapeutic product candidate that suppresses all HBV antigens, including HBsAg expression.
